Achyranthes is a genus of medicinal and ornamental plants in the amaranth family, Amaranthaceae. Chaff flower is a common name for plants in this genus.Species include:
Achyranthes ancistrophora C.C.Towns.
Achyranthes arborescens R.Br.
Achyranthes aspera L. (= A. argentea) (Sanskrit : apamarg (अपामार्ग))
Achyranthes atollensis (extinct)
Achyranthes bidentata Blume
Achyranthes coynei Santapau
Achyranthes diandra Roxb.
Achyranthes fasciculata (Suess.) C.C.Towns.
Achyranthes mangarevica Suess.
